Mother kills young son in north Nicosia

Tragic case of child murder shocks Kioneli residents

Newsroom

A woman in north Nicosia is in police custody and on suicide watch, after stabbing her young son to death, with Turkish Cypriot media saying she got upset over an imminent custody battle.

The 36-year-old mother, who stabbed her 7-year-old son on Sunday in their apartment in the suburb of Kionel, appeared before a Turkish Cypriot court on Tuesday where she was remanded for three days. 

Turkish Cypriot media say the woman had been separated from her husband and she stabbed her little boy upon learning that her husband would seek full child custody.

Reports also say that the 36-year-old lied down next to her dead son on the bed and later, when she began to fully realise what she had done, she reportedly attempted to commit suicide. 

The boy’s grandfather reportedly died of a heart attack when he saw what had happened.

A knife believed to be the murder weapon has been found in the residence according to local reports.
